I was a little apprehensive about doing this experience however it turned out to be one of the most fun action-packed days I've had in a long time! Being a bit of an adrenaline junkie, I felt like I had 'done everything' but canyoning (or 'gorge walking') was a completely different experience altogether! Think: heights, water, abseiling, swimming, jumping, climbing and picturesque mountains and you pretty much have canyoning summed up! I didn't realise there was an experience that encompassed all the adrenaline staples in one go, however canyoning did just that.
We arrived at Bala Watersports in the morning and quickly got changed into wetsuits (Bala provide these, you just need to bring your own swimwear, towels and trainers). We then drove in convoy to the Snowdonia National Park and got suited up in buoyancy aids, harnesses and helmets. After this we walked down through the mountains and got to our starting point. There was certainly no 'easing in to it'! One at a time we stood with our backs to the water, arms crossed across our bodies, and 'fell' back into the water off the rock edge. After that it just got more and more fun and adrenaline filled! We swam through pools of water, jumped off high rocks, abseiled down a cliff into more water, dropped off the edge of waterfalls... and much more. There wasn't time to get scared or worked up about anything, although if you really did not want to participate in a particular part you could opt out.
Our instructor, Will, put everyone at ease and ensured we were all safe whilst having a great time. At no point did I feel the 'health and safety' bore taking its toll on our fun filled day, yet I felt safe and secure throughout the experience.
After an action-packed and fun filled few hours we headed back up to the top of the mountains and got changed into some very welcome warm clothing and ate lunch. I honestly had such an amazing day and cannot wait to do this again! I would highly recommend to all adrenaline junkies out there.
